Post by: Topple on April 10, 2005, 22:01:05
Glad it gets the seal of approval  :lol:  :lol:

put on a new wing and headlight panel, before wet & drying everything, white was the ideal base so made life easier.  There were some areas of rust on the capping and onthe bulkhead behinf the bonnet. Any dodgy areas were taken to bare metal, etched primed and then high build primer before top coating.

There were also some dents on the doors i filled in and primed.

Preparation took two very long days. 8am - 10pm both days.
Spraying 3 days

adding all the bits on and rebuilding 2 days.

Started the the thursday before easter, put the final touches on today.
